W: Good morning. Can I help you?
M: Yes, please. I’m a new student and I’d like to have some information about the accommodation.
W: Right.(12-1)The university provides two types of accommodation, halls of residence and self-catering accommodation.
M: How much does it cost for the self-catering accommodation?
W: For a single room, £37.86 per week, that’s about £5.41 a day.(13)For a double room, it’s £52 per week.
M: I’d like the self-catering accommodation. How far is it from the residence to the university?
W: It all depends. The residence at 110 Palm Street is about one and a half miles from the university main site and the Freemen’s Common Houses at William Road is about half a mile.
M: When do I need to apply?
W: Are you an undergraduate or a postgraduate?
M: Undergraduate.
W: Then you should apply for it as soon as possible,(14/15)since places in university-owned accommodation are limited and if you don’t apply before the end of the month, you are not likely to get a place.
M: Could you possibly tell me what to do, if no vacancy is available?
W:(12-2)Yes, you may consider private accommodation. The university runs an Accommodation Information Office and its staff will help you.
M: Where’s the office?
W: In the Students’ Union Building.
M: Whom can I contact?
W: Mr. Underwood. David Underwood, the manager of the Accommodation Information Office.
M: Thanks a lot.
W: My pleasure.
Questions 12 to 15 are based on the conversation you have just heard.
12. What do we know from the conversation?
13. How much does a double room cost per day for the self-catering accommodation?
14. When should the man apply if he wants a university-owned accommodation?
15. What can be inferred from the conversation?
选项
A、Self-catering accommodation is very far from the university.
B、If a student wants a private accommodation, he may call the Students’ Union.
C、A student may live where he or she likes.
D、There are limited places in university-owned accommodation.
答案
D
